Skin Nourishing Foods According to Ayurveda

December 2, 2024

Ayurveda says that treating internal issues is more pivotal than external prompts. Along these lines, taking care of the skin is essential for having healthy and flawless skin. The right food will give your skin the required nourishment, fix damaged skin cells, and battle skin hypersensitivities and infections.

There are many cures, food varieties, and treatments in Ayurveda that assist you with keeping up with skin health by keeping allergies and infections under control.

Some foods recommended by Ayurveda for better skin are:

Turmeric – Turmeric is one of the most commonly used spices in Indian recipes for years. It is known for its blood purifying, anti-bacterial and anti-ageing properties. Turmeric likewise helps in decreasing acne, blemishes, pigmentation and aggravation.

You can add turmeric as a flavour in your prepared food or drink turmeric milk before sleeping. You can also use it as a facial covering by blending it with rice powder, crude milk or tomato juice. Turmeric is beneficial for all skin types (Vata, Pitta and Kapha).

Saffron – Saffron is also the most generally involved spice in India. It is well known for its skin-lightening properties. Saffron additionally battles with pigmentation, dark spots, and other skin imperfections.

You can apply or consume Saffron by absorbing a couple of strands of warm milk overnight. You can similarly make a paste by soaking some strands of Saffron in water and afterwards adding two tablespoons of turmeric powderand applying it to the face and neck. Saffron is the most appropriate for Pitta and Kapha skin types.

Whole Grain Cereals – Whole grain cereals contain fibre which is remarkably helpful for digestion. They are healthy and belly-filling. Whole grains are plentiful in nutrients, minerals, proteins and plant compounds. A few sorts of whole-grain oats additionally contain Zinc, Vitamin C, iron, and other fundamental minerals, which keep your skin healthy and shining, while likewise further developing skin texture. These grains have a total feast in themselves as they are loaded with a ton of benefits.

Oatmeal, brown rice, millet, wild rice, wheat berry, buckwheat, grain and so forth are the various assortments that incorporate whole grains.

Fruits – Fruit meals are an effective way of having healthy glowing skin. They are great for the general wellness of the body. Natural products like pomegranate, papaya, berries, mangoes and prunes help you in getting sound sparkling skin as they are plentiful in nutrients, magnesium, potassium, folic corrosive, pantothenic corrosive, and dietary filaments. They are extraordinary for easing up the complexion, making the general composition even, reestablishing and reconstructing the damaged skin. You can likewise involve the pulps as facial coverings.

Fruits like berries, pomegranates, and mangoes assist with making the skin pale to pink, further develop skin surface, reestablish solid cells, and treat dry, textured, and harsh skin.

Cucumber (Kheera) – Cucumber, otherwise called Kheera, is exceptionally useful for the skin as it is a water-based fruit. It helps keep us hydrated and keep the skin cool, wet, and firm. It battles acne, shields skin from hurtful UV beams, makes complexion even, forestalls wrinkles, recuperates scars,offers a cooling impact on the skin, tones and fixes the skin and fixes the damaged skin cells.

You can apply or consume cucumber in numerous ways; you can have it in yoghurt, raita, or salad. You can drink cucumber squeeze or apply it straightforwardly to the face and eyes.

The Ayurvedic secret behind impeccable skin is eating ideal for your mind-body type, including probably the best food varieties for gleaming skin. To get healthy skin, you don’t have to spend a fortune on beauty care products. You just need to adhere to an everyday skincare routine with normal items and take the right nutrition for your skin.
